General

Mistress Daelvin is the innkeeper of The Golden Stag in Maerone, Cairhien. She is small and round with her wispy gray hair in a bun at the nape of her neck.

Despite her placid appearance, she keeps a cudgel under her skirts and uses it on men that she thinks are behaving improperly.

Mat and some of the lords and officers of the Band of the Red Hand stay at her inn. When Mat begins flirting with Betse, the serving maid is afraid that Mistress Daelvin might disapprove if she sat there drinking wine with Mat. But when Mistress Daelvin sees Betse, she waves them on.

Most of her profit comes from the wine and that she can usually only sell in the evening.

(Reference: Lord of Chaos, Chapter 5)

Quotes

"Maybe Mistress Daelvin had worked out some sort of schedule. If she had, Betse was an exception. That slender young woman fetched wine for no one but Mat, danced with no one but Mat, and the innkeeper beamed at them so much like a mother at her daughter's wedding that it made Mat uncomfortable." (Mat on Mistress Daelvin and Betse; Lord of Chaos, Chapter 5)
